The Mechanics Behind No KYC Casinos

No KYC casinos operate with a different verification approach, often relying on instant payment solutions like Trustly or technologies such as BankID, which confirm a player’s identity during deposits without additional paperwork. These systems also enable quicker withdrawals, sometimes within minutes, a stark contrast to the days-long waits common in regulated casinos.

While this speed is appealing, it means these casinos must carefully balance regulatory compliance with the promise of anonymity. Notably, many platforms that adopt the no KYC model work under reputable licenses from regulators like Lotteritilsynet, ensuring a level of security even without traditional document checks.

Benefits and Potential Pitfalls of Skipping KYC

What makes no KYC casinos attractive goes beyond convenience. For users wary of sharing sensitive personal data online, this model offers a welcome alternative. It can also reduce the friction of onboarding, making the whole gambling experience more spontaneous and enjoyable.

However, this approach is not without drawbacks. Less stringent identity checks could potentially invite misuse, and there’s often less protection against fraud or money laundering. Players should be aware that some no KYC casinos might have limitations on maximum withdrawal amounts or specific restrictions on payment methods to compensate for the reduced verification process.
